In a CT machine, the production of X-rays requires:

  1. A source of electrons
  2. A means of rapid acceleration of electrons
  3. A means of rapid deceleration of electrons

The electrons are ejected from an electron source, and accelerated toward a target by an electric field, and when they strike the target, x-rays are produced.
